Manual: Backend Typescript Engineer

Related keywords: mental health remote jobremote job washingtonremote job denver

This page contains product affiliate links.

Overview

MANUAL is a company dedicated to the personal development and mental wellness of young men, particularly those from underserved communities. Based in Washington, D.C., MANUAL operates using a digital platform aimed at addressing the challenges young men face in higher education. With a focus on organizations like high schools and universities, including notable partnerships with institutions such as Morgan State University and MSU-Denver, MANUAL aims to reach tens of thousands of youth each year, offering programs designed to enhance both their success and mental health outcomes.

Company Mission

The mission of MANUAL is clear—inspire young men to realize their full potential by promoting mental wellness. In light of rising mental health crises affecting young males, especially amongst communities of color, MANUAL is committed to developing programs that can directly engage this demographic. The organization’s innovative approaches have drawn support from numerous investors, including established names in venture capital and healthcare.

Role Overview

The role being offered is for a Backend Typescript Engineer, a full-time position that operates within a remote work environment—although there may be occasional team gatherings. The ideal candidate will not just be required to develop software solutions, but they will also get a chance to directly impact how young men interact with mental wellness resources. Successful applicants should possess a blend of technical skills and the enthusiasm to help create scalable applications using Typescript.

Key Responsibilities

The position entails a variety of responsibilities, primarily focusing on backend development tasks. Here’s what you will be doing:

  • Leading the development of the RedwoodJS backend which serves as APIs for NextJS and React Native applications.

  • Managing the PostgreSQL database and backend infrastructure.

  • Participating in user feedback sessions to improve solutions based on direct user input.

  • Assisting in the hiring process for future engineers, thus contributing to the growth and development of the engineering team.

  • Collaborating with the head of engineering and team members on various projects, including both backend and frontend tasks.

Ideal Candidate Profile

MANUAL seeks individuals who are not only passionate about technology but also share a dedication to social impact. Key traits of the successful candidate include:



  • Solid understanding of Typescript and the JavaScript ecosystem, coupled with practical experience in developing web applications and APIs.

  • A problem-solving mindset, capable of navigating challenges in a fast-paced startup environment.

  • Team players who value open communication and collaboration, ready to contribute to a growing team.

  • Lifelong learners who are eager to embrace new ideas and experiences, fostering a culture of mutual growth.

Requirements

Interestingly, the company emphasizes that the number of years of experience is not a primary concern. Instead, a demonstrated ability to apply knowledge and experience in real-world scenarios matters most. Candidates are advised that development of production code is essential, and they encourage applicants from diverse educational backgrounds. Having a traditional degree in computer science is not a strict requirement.

Compensation and Benefits

Compensation for this position ranges from $125,000 to $150,000 annually, depending on experience and skills. Additional benefits include:

  • Fully covered health, dental, and vision insurance, meaning no contribution from the employee.

  • Unlimited PTO, offering a flexible work-life balance.

Hiring Process

The hiring process is designed to gauge both technical skills and team fit, comprising several steps:

  1. An initial 30-minute interview focusing on the applicant's background and experience.

  2. A take-home project which allows candidates to demonstrate their problem-solving approach, with at least 5 days to complete it.

  3. A 45-minute technical interview based on the take-home project, facilitating discussion on the technical knowledge of the candidate.

  4. A final 30-minute interview with team members to evaluate team compatibility before extending an offer.

Conclusion

Being part of MANUAL means contributing not only to technological development but also to the critical mission of enhancing the lives of young men across the nations. If you're technically proficient and passionate about making a social difference, this role could be an excellent opportunity. Pay attention to prepare for the unique interview stages, and ensure you express how you can leverage your skills for impactful development work.



This job offer was originally published on weworkremotely.com

MANUAL

Washington, District of Columbia, United States

Software development

Full-time

January 9, 2025

9 views

1 clicks on Apply Now

Share


Similar job offers


This job offer summary has been generated using automated technology. While we strive for accuracy, it may not always fully capture the nuances and details of the original job posting. We recommend reviewing the complete job listing before making any decisions or applications.